The landscape of cryptocurrency project funding is undergoing a notable transformation, moving away from the speculative fervor of prior bull markets toward a more discerning and sustainable capital allocation strategy. While overall investment volumes remain modest compared to the peaks of 2021 and 2022, recent trends indicate a qualitative shift that could foster long-term ecosystem stability.

This evolution is characterized by a departure from the proliferation of new, independent blockchain networks. Instead, capital is increasingly directed towards entities with substantial digital asset reserves that are actively building upon and enhancing existing decentralized protocols and infrastructure. This strategic pivot, highlighted by analyst Daan Crypto Trades, reflects a market preference for demonstrable utility and integration over novel, unproven foundational layers. Consequently, a significant portion of available capital is being channeled into liquid markets, reducing the frequency and size of funding rounds for entirely new blockchain initiatives.

While this has led to a noticeable reduction in the overall volume and frequency of fundraising activities compared to the frenetic pace witnessed during prior bull runs, market observers view this shift as largely beneficial. Analysts suggest that this recalibration has paved the way for more resilient market dynamics. A crucial aspect of this trend is the adoption of more conservative initial valuations for new token issuances. This approach aims to mitigate the extreme “boom and bust” cycles that characterized earlier periods, fostering more stable price discovery and long-term project viability post-launch.

Data from DeFiLlama visually corroborates this trend, showing monthly funding peaking at over $7 billion in early 2022 before contracting significantly, albeit with occasional surges observed into 2025. This stabilization is widely regarded as a constructive development, providing both nascent projects and seasoned investors with a more predictable and sustainable operational environment. As Daan Crypto Trades further explains, these reduced entry valuations afford projects ample room for potential appreciation once their underlying utility and value proposition are validated in the market. Ultimately, this paradigm shift signifies a more balanced risk-reward profile for market participants and underscores a broader maturation within the cryptocurrency ecosystem’s approach to capital deployment.
